The updated Mahindra Bolero Neo has finally been spotted on Indian roads while undergoing testing. This is the first time since its launch in 2021 that the SUV has been caught with changes to its design. The sighting suggests that Mahindra is working on a facelifted version that could reach showrooms soon. With subtle updates outside and some expected new features inside the popular sub 4m SUV is gearing up for its next chapter
Back in July 2021 Mahindra introduced the Bolero Neo as a refreshed and rebadged version of the TUV300. The aim was to merge the rugged appeal of the Bolero brand with a more city friendly SUV design. Since then the Bolero Neo has stayed largely the same, without any major updates. Now, with the facelift in development, Mahindra seems ready to bring something fresh to the table.

The current Bolero Neo already offers a mix of useful features many of which are expected to be retained in the facelift
At present the Bolero Neo is equipped with dual front airbags, ABS with EBD, ISOFIX child seat mounts and a rear view camera with sensors.

The updated Mahindra Bolero Neo is expected to continue with the same tried-and-tested engine as the current version.
This engine has been a reliable workhorse for the SUV, known for its strong low-end torque, which helps it tackle both city traffic and rough rural roads. It is unlikely that Mahindra will add a petrol option, given that the Bolero Neo has always been positioned as a diesel-first product.
Currently, the Bolero Neo is priced between ₹9.97 lakh and ₹12.18 lakh (ex-showroom, post-GST cut). With the upcoming updates, the price is expected to rise slightly, possibly by ₹50,000 to ₹70,000 depending on the variant.
Even with the price hike, the SUV will remain one of the most affordable body-on-frame SUVs in India.
The updated Mahindra Bolero Neo does not have a direct rival in the Indian market because of its unique positioning. It is a rugged, rear-wheel-drive sub-4m SUV, while most other options in this size are front-wheel-drive crossovers.
